Story summary
- The fragile Pakistan–Afghanistan ceasefire has been extended after deadly clashes and casualties.
- The ceasefire was initially 48 hours, agreed after violence along the Durand Line, with both sides accusing each other.
- Pakistan's military reported a suicide attack in North Waziristan linked to the Tehrik-e-Taliban Pakistan (TTP).
- Analysts say tensions remain, and mediation by Qatar and Saudi Arabia is crucial for lasting peace.
